InBuild vs Shopify

The dominant e-commerce platform — built for selling, not for general websites.

Shopify is the standard for online stores: inventory, payments, fulfillment, multi-channel selling. InBuild and Shopify aren't direct competitors — but if you're choosing where to start a brand-new online business, the question is real. Pick Shopify when commerce is the product. Pick InBuild when content + marketing site is the product and commerce is a feature.

Pick Shopify when

  • Commerce is your business — you need inventory, fulfillment, multi-channel selling, payment processing all stitched together
  • You want a mature app ecosystem for shipping, taxes, returns, dropshipping
  • Your scale demands battle-tested e-commerce infra (multi-warehouse, B2B pricing, etc.)

Pick InBuild when

  • Your site is content-first with commerce as an add-on — a portfolio that sells prints, a course landing page with checkout, a newsletter with paid subscriptions
  • You want full design control without Shopify theme constraints
  • AI generation is part of how you want to build the site itself
  • You want clean Next.js code and you'll layer Stripe Checkout or Lemon Squeezy on top — full control with simpler infrastructure
The verdict

If you're running a store with inventory, shipping, returns, multi-channel — Shopify. If you're running a content-led site that sells one product or a few simple ones — InBuild with Stripe Checkout is leaner and you own the code.

Frequently asked questions

Can InBuild replace Shopify?

For low-volume / digital-product / single-product commerce, yes — connect Stripe Checkout in the exported code. For real e-commerce ops (inventory, multi-warehouse, returns, marketplaces), Shopify is the mature choice.

Can I embed a Shopify store inside an InBuild site?

Yes. Build the marketing site on InBuild, export the code, and use Shopify's Buy Button or the Storefront API to embed cart and checkout in the relevant pages.

InBuild vs Shopify for a course creator?

InBuild — courses are content + a single checkout. Shopify's overhead pays off when you have a real catalog. For a course creator, the InBuild landing page + Stripe Checkout + a course host (Mux, Vimeo) is leaner.
